Hi, Patrik,
I hand lay my track using code 197 N/S rail. None of my rolling stock hits the spike heads and I run both LGB and Bachmann equipment.
OLD DAD
I’ll second that. I’m using Code215 handlaid turnouts and Code215 commercial track. Not a problem with either Bachmann or LGB flanges. Make sure your wheel sets are in gauge!
